Arjun is an associate in the London office. He has experience advising and representing corporates, States and State-owned entities in commercial and investment arbitrations across various sectors including media, infrastructure, and energy, under the ICC, LCIA, ICSID, and Swiss Rules. Arjun has also advised and represented clients in arbitration-related court litigation.
Arjun is admitted to practice in India and England & Wales and holds an LL.M. from the MIDS programme in Geneva.

Securing a favourable award for a Spanish engineering company in an ICC arbitration for delay and cost claims arising from the construction of one of the world’s largest integrated gasification combined cycle power plants, located in the Middle East
Representing a Balkan State in an ICC arbitration for delay and cost claims arising from the construction of wastewater infrastructure
Representing a PETRONAS subsidiary in an ICSID arbitration against the Republic of South Sudan for disputes arising from substantial interests in petroleum assets
Representing a South Asian media conglomerate in an LCIA arbitration arising from a media sublicensing agreement for the broadcast of sports events
Representing a Greek engineering company in a Zurich-seated arbitration relating to disputes arising from the construction of a combined cycle power plant in the Middle East
Advising an Asian State-owned entity on the recognition and enforcement of a multi-billion-dollar award against assets across over 30 jurisdictions
Securing a favourable award for a Spanish construction company against an Indian State-owned entity, for delay and cost claims arising from the construction of electricity transmission and distribution infrastructure
Securing a favourable award for the governing body for cricket in India in an arbitration brought by a former team in the Indian Premier League seeking damages for termination
Representing the promoters of an Indian wind turbine manufacturer in shareholder and technology licensing disputes with their German joint-venture partners, across various Indian courts and tribunals
